Average Life Expectancy of Oral Implants
When taking into consideration oral implants, among the essential questions is their life expectancy. Typically, you can expect oral implants to last anywhere from 10 to 15 years, and lots of even last a lifetime with correct care. Unlike all-natural teeth, implants don't struggle with degeneration, which adds to their durability.
Nonetheless, it's important to maintain great oral health and stay on top of routine oral check outs to guarantee they remain in good condition.

Secret Variables Influencing Longevity
A number of key aspects can dramatically affect the longevity of your dental implants. First, the high quality of the implant itself plays an important function. Premium materials and advanced technology tend to generate much better outcomes and resilience.

Your general oral wellness is an additional crucial variable. If you have periodontal condition or other dental problems, it can threaten the security of your implants. Maintaining a healthy and balanced lifestyle, including a balanced diet and avoiding smoking, helps promote recovery and longevity.
In addition, your body's capability to heal and integrate the dental implant affects its life-span. Private elements like age, medical problems, and drugs can affect this process.
Ultimately, your bite and just how you use your teeth can influence the long life of the implants. Extreme grinding or clinching can result in early wear.
Maintenance for Resilient Implants
Keeping your dental implants is necessary for ensuring their long life and optimum feature. First, you ought to stick to a rigorous oral health regimen. Brush your teeth two times a day with a soft-bristle toothbrush and non-abrasive tooth paste to prevent damaging the dental implant surface.
Do not neglect to floss daily, as it assists get rid of food bits and plaque that can cause periodontal condition.
Normal dental examinations are likewise important. Set up specialist cleanings and exams a minimum of two times a year. Your dental practitioner can monitor the health of your periodontals and the honesty of the implants, addressing any type of issues prior to they rise.
In addition, be mindful of your diet regimen. Stay clear of difficult or sticky foods that can emphasize your implants. If you grind your teeth, consider putting on a nightguard to safeguard your oral work.
Finally, stay clear of tobacco products, as they can hamper recovery and contribute to dental implant failing.
